Jon Anderson <jon.anderson () oracle com> wrote:
> I recently had a change merged with the-tcpdump-group/libpcap
> (39540b9e1c4a9e4343c6cab77ee66e054f6bce51)
> Is there any way to tell which libpcap version this change will
> distributed with?
General answer:
Unless someone said that they pulled it up to libpcap 1.6, it will likely
come out with libpcap 1.7, which ought to be November 2014. [releases tend
to be synchronized with IETF meetings]
If you want to pull it up to the libpcap-1.6 branch and submit a pull
request, and there is a reason to release a 1.6.3, that could happen.
I see that Guy actually pulled your patch up to the 1.6 tree.
If this is a critical fix, I can push the button on 1.6.3 once I'm back
in the same building as the USB key that can sign it, which should be
in about 12 hours.
